The (specifically version v3.0.7 ) is a utility designed to help owners of Volkswagen, Skoda, and Seat vehicles update their RNS 510 navigation units by copying map data from an SD card instead of a DVD. This is particularly useful for units with worn-out disc lasers that struggle to read dual-layer DVDs. Download Sources

The progress bar often stays at 31% for the duration of the process. Do not panic; this is normal behavior. The total time is usually about 30–60 minutes .
